A bearish … Web14 dec. 2024 · The main difference between the bull and bear flag patterns is the direction of the trend. The bullish flag pattern occurs in an uptrend, while the bearish flag pattern appears in a downtrend. These patterns are helpful for traders who wish to take advantage of short-term and long-term market trends.
